The Nueva York to Toluca corridor represents a vital cross-border freight transportation route connecting the economic powerhouse of the northeastern United States with Mexico's industrial heartland. This 3,407-kilometer corridor facilitates the movement of goods between one of America's largest metropolitan areas and the thriving manufacturing center of the State of Mexico. The route traverses diverse landscapes and crosses multiple state lines, requiring expert logistics coordination to ensure timely and compliant delivery.
The economic significance of this corridor is substantial, supporting trade between the United States and Mexico under the USMCA framework. Nueva York serves as a major entry point for international cargo arriving at ports like New York/New Jersey, while Toluca has emerged as a key industrial hub for automotive, aerospace, and electronics manufacturing. The corridor enables just-in-time supply chains that are critical for both American and Mexican industries, particularly in sectors where production schedules are tightly integrated across borders.
Transportation along this corridor relies on major interstate highways including I-95, I-40, and I-35, connecting through strategic border crossings such as Laredo or El Paso. Origin
New York City
Nueva York stands as one of the most strategically important logistics hubs in the United States, serving as a gateway for international trade entering the country through the Port of New York and New Jersey. The region's extensive transportation infrastructure includes major airports, rail terminals, and highway connections that facilitate efficient distribution throughout the northeastern corridor. Nueva York's diverse economy spans finance, technology, media, and manufacturing sectors, creating substantial freight transportation demand. The metropolitan area's proximity to major ports and its role as a distribution center for goods bound for destinations across the United States makes it an ideal origin point for cross-border freight movements to Mexico.
Destination
Toluca
Toluca, the capital of the State of Mexico, represents a strategic logistics and industrial center due to its proximity to Mexico City and its own thriving manufacturing sector. The city and surrounding region host numerous industrial parks specializing in automotive, aerospace, and electronics production, with companies like Chrysler, General Motors, and various aerospace suppliers maintaining significant operations.
